The purpose of the Project Master Schedule is to combine, coordinate, and track schedules produced by the Design/Builder and other Project team members throughout the course of the Project.
The Construction Project Manager shall be responsible for maintaining, updating and distributing the Project Master Schedule.
The Project Master Schedule will also include Contract Milestone dates (Exhibit A) and the Design/Builder's Baseline Schedule, and shall be utilized by the District and the Design/Builder to identify any coordination issues and/or conflicts with other Project team members under separate contract.
